George Hoyningen Huene. Art. Fashion.Cinema

George Hoyningen-Huene, Sonia Colmer, Vionnet Pyjamas 1, 1931 © George Hoyningen-Huene Estate Archives

The brilliant fashion photographer is the protagonist of a prestigious exhibition hosted at the Museo di Roma - Palazzo Braschi, which, through over 100 photos, depicts the refined and timeless elegance of a master of the lens 125 years after his birth.

Curated by Susanna Brown, the exhibition path, for the first time in Rome, explores the career and elegant creative universe of George Hoyningen-Huene between platinum prints and shots that combine classical and avant-garde art.

The images are astonishing testimonies of the style and innovative techniques of the artist who revolutionised the aesthetics of photography, chief photographer of French Vogue from 1926 to 1936. Surrealist influences, portraits of artists and celebrities, and collaborations with iconic haute couture legends such as Chanel, Balenciaga, Schiaparelli and Cartier are unveiled in an evocative visual journey through ten different thematic sections: George Hoyningen-Huene: Visions of an Era; Between Jazz and Ballets Russes: Dreams of Beauty in the City of Light; Beachwear and the Fascination of the Ideal Body; Reflections of Antiquity; Mirages of Light: Huene’s Visual Odyssey; Sculptures of Light: the Male Nude between Classical and Modern; The Essence of Dreams: Huene, Chanel, and the influence of Surrealism; Star Models: New Icons of Modernity; The Fashion of Harper’s Bazaar; Hollywood and the Allure of Cinema.

The photos on display include iconic portraits of personalities such as the photographers Horst P. Horst and Lee Miller, one of the exhibition's protagonists, Jean Cocteau, Agneta Fischer, Ingrid Bergman, Charlie ChaplinGreta GarboAva GardnerKatharine HepburnJosephine BakerJean BarrySalvador DalìPablo PicassoPaul Eluard and the etoiles Serge Lifar and Olga Spessivtzeva.

The exhibition is promoted by Roma Capitale, Assessorato alla Cultura, Sovrintendenza Capitolina ai Beni Culturali and realised by CMS.Cultura, under the patronage of the Ministry of Culture and the Institut Français Italia, in collaboration with the George Hoyningen-Huene Archive (Stockholm, Sweden).
